The Breakdown 9

  • In a bold claim, former President Donald Trump stated that the CIA informed him Iran's new Supreme Leader, Mojtaba Khamenei, may be gay, raising eyebrows amidst the country's harsh laws against homosexuality.
  • This assertion highlights the severe persecution faced by LGBTQ+ individuals in Iran, where same-sex relations can lead to penalties as dire as death.
  • Trump made these comments during a Fox News interview, suggesting that Khamenei's alleged sexual orientation could adversely affect his position and relationships within the conservative regime.
  • As Khamenei assumes leadership, Trump's remarks add fuel to the already tense U.S.-Iran relations, intricately linking personal allegations to broader geopolitical dynamics.
  • The discourse surrounding this issue invites deeper reflection on Iran's societal attitudes toward homosexuality and the implications of such revelations on internal politics.
  • Media coverage varies in tone but centers on the potential ramifications of Trump's claim, illustrating its significance in both political and cultural contexts.

How does Iran's law treat homosexuality?

In Iran, homosexuality is criminalized under Islamic law, with severe penalties, including the death penalty. The Iranian government enforces strict social norms regarding sexual orientation, and LGBTQ+ individuals face systemic persecution. This legal framework reflects broader societal attitudes shaped by cultural and religious beliefs, making Iran one of the most dangerous places for LGBTQ+ individuals.

What are the historical ties between the US and Iran?

U.S.-Iran relations have been historically complex, marked by cooperation and conflict. Initially, the U.S. supported the Shah of Iran until the 1979 Islamic Revolution, which led to the establishment of the current theocratic regime. The subsequent hostage crisis and sanctions worsened relations, leading to decades of animosity characterized by mutual distrust and geopolitical rivalry, especially concerning nuclear proliferation and regional influence.

How has LGBTQ+ rights evolved in Iran?

LGBTQ+ rights in Iran have seen little progress since the 1979 Islamic Revolution, when homosexuality was criminalized. The regime enforces harsh penalties, including imprisonment and execution. Despite some underground movements advocating for rights, public expression remains severely restricted. Internationally, Iran's treatment of LGBTQ+ individuals has drawn condemnation, highlighting the stark contrast between Western liberal values and Iran's conservative legal framework.
